Insurance

Truck accidents can be catastrophic which can cause serious injuries and substantial damage to property and vehicles. Due to their huge size and weight, commercial trucks often carry multiple layers of insurance to help pay for these damages. If you find that the driver of the truck who plowed into your vehicle was not insured, or had only the minimum amount of coverage required, you may think that you won't be able to get compensation for the damages you've suffered. A lawyer for truck accidents could also examine your auto insurance policy to see whether there are other coverages that might apply to your crash. Medical payments (also known as medpay or Personal Injury Protection) may cover a part of the medical expenses you incur, dependent on the insurance laws in your state. In addition, some states require UM/UIM (uninsured/underinsured motorist) coverage, which pays for your losses in the event you are injured by an at-fault driver who doesn't have any or enough car insurance to cover your damages.

Malone Semi Truck Accident Lawsuit-truck accident victims can claim compensation for both economic damages and non-economic losses. Economic damages are a result of the past, present, as well as future medical expenses as well as lost wages, repairs to vehicles, and vehicle maintenance costs. Non-economic damages are more complex and include things like mental apprehension, pain and suffering, and loss of enjoyment your life. Liability

Trucking accidents are among the most hazardous on the road, and a crash with one of these giant vehicles can result in devastating damage. Since trucks weigh as much as an 80,000-pound weight, they exert immense force when they collide with cars or other vehicles, and this could result in severe property injuries and damage to the body. In certain cases, the lakemoor semi truck accident attorney-truck driver may be held accountable for an accident. However it isn't always the situation. The trucking company they work for could be held accountable when it is proved that they made the driver work to meet deadlines within an unreasonable time frame or cut corners in maintenance and safety. Owners of trucks who leased them to the trucking firm instead of owning them outright are liable.

The police report, witness testimony and other sources may provide evidence in a truck accident case. Information about the driving history of the truck driver, as well as any prior traffic violations are also crucial. In some instances an accident could be caused by a defective component, which could make the manufacturer accountable.
